Offline-first Apple Health analysis
Offline Apple Health Analysis
Yes — you can analyze Apple Health data offline-first. Export from iPhone, convert export.xml locally, or sync to the Mac app over local WiFi, then review private summaries before sharing anything with cloud AI tools.
Quick decision
| Goal | Offline-first path | What stays local |
|---|---|---|
| One-time archive review | Apple Health export → local browser converter | The raw export.xml file is read by your browser on your own device. |
| Mac trend analysis | Direct to Mac local sync | iPhone and Mac communicate over your local network without iCloud or a cloud storage hop. |
| AI-ready health summary | Local charts and selected CSV/JSON slices first | You choose the small summary or date range before using ChatGPT, Claude, Gemini, or Perplexity. |
| Agent or local API workflow | Mac app local API on 127.0.0.1 | Tools on the same Mac can read prepared metrics without uploading the full archive. |
Where we lose
This is an offline-first analysis workflow, not a medical diagnosis service and not a promise that every AI step is offline. If you use a cloud AI assistant, that assistant may process what you paste or upload. The safer workflow is to create a local summary first and only share the minimum needed for the question.
The offline Apple Health workflow
- Export Apple Health from iPhone, or use Direct to Mac sync when you want a no-cloud transfer.
- Convert
export.xmlto CSV, JSON, or Excel in the browser if you already have Apple's raw export. - Review sleep, steps, workouts, heart rate, HRV, and other trends locally on your Mac before involving any external AI.
- Create a small summary file or paste only the relevant rows into your AI assistant if you want explanation or research context.
